2025 Compare Cities Politics & Voting:
Algonac, MI vs Redwood City, CA
Change Cities
Highlights
- Registered voters in Redwood City are 140.4% more likely to be registered as Democrats than registered voters in Algonac.
- Registered voters in Algonac, are 52.6% less likely to be registered as Democrats, than in the rest of the United States.
